Abstract

Описан способ повышения проницаемости подземного пласта, в котором количество водной смеси, достаточное для повышения проницаемости пласта, содержащей определенные аминополикарбоновые анионные частицы и определенные катионные частицы, вводят в материнскую породу пласта.Международная заявка была опубликована вместе с отчетом о международном поиске.
